Brialliant Tour - We had a fantastic tour with Aimad, We were two adults and two teens and the length of the trip was perfect. We learnt so much from the knowledgeable Aimad and loved the route around the new town and the old Medina. The highlight was visiting the community bakery and seeing how bread was baked for the neighbourhood. The bakery make their own bread but also locals arrive with their dough wrapped in tea towels on their trays and it gets added to the hundreds of loaves being baked. ... and the master knows which loaf belong to which person. The dough gets placed in the oven at an incredible speed so fascinating to watch. Also cycling like a local through the Medina was amazing
